Massachusetts Financial Services Co. MA Has $1.97 Billion Stock Position in Howmet Aerospace Inc. (NYSE:HWM)

Howmet Aerospace logo with Aerospace background

Massachusetts Financial Services Co. MA decreased its holdings in shares of Howmet Aerospace Inc. (NYSE:HWM - Free Report) by 9.5% during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 15,161,551 shares of the company's stock after selling 1,595,525 shares during the quarter. Massachusetts Financial Services Co. MA owned about 3.75% of Howmet Aerospace worth $1,966,908,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Insider Buying and Selling at Howmet Aerospace

In other Howmet Aerospace news, EVP Neil Edward Marchuk sold 30,000 shares of the company's st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, May 12th. The shares were sold at an average price of $158.53, for a total value of $4,755,900.00. Following the transaction, the executive vice president owned 131,859 shares in the company, valued at approximately $20,903,607.27. This represents a 18.53%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available through the SEC website. Also, VP Barbara Lou Shultz sold 1,250 shares of the company's st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, May 5th. The shares were sold at an average price of $155.17, for a total transaction of $193,962.50. Following the completion of the transaction, the vice president owned 23,044 shares in the company, valued at approximately $3,575,737.48. This represents a 5.15% dec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. In the last quarter, insiders have sold 831,250 shares of company stock worth $130,517,863. 1.04% of the stock is currently owned by company insiders.

Howmet Aerospace Stock Up 2.0%

Howmet Aerospace stock traded up $3.67 during trading hours on Thursday, hitting $187.97. The company had a trading volume of 1,242,859 shares, compared to its average volume of 2,794,125. The firm has a market capitalization of $75.88 billion, a P/E ratio of 61.20,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.71 and a beta of 1.43.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.70, a current ratio of 2.30 and a quick ratio of 1.07. The firm's fifty day moving average is $172.10 and its 200-day moving average is $142.97. Howmet Aerospace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$77.22 and a fifty-two week high of $188.03.

Howmet Aerospace (NYSE:HWM -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 1st. The company reported $0.86 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.77 by $0.09. The firm had revenue of $1.94 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.94 billion. Howmet Aerospace had a net margin of 16.64% and a return on equity of 27.25%.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 5.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$0.53 EPS. On average, research analysts forecast that Howmet Aerospace Inc. will post 3.27 earnings per share for the current year.

About Howmet Aerospace

(Free Report)

Howmet Aerospace Inc provides advanced engineered solutions for the aerospace and transportation industries in the United States, Japan, France, Germany, the United Kingdom, Mexico, Italy, Canada, Poland, China, and internationally. It operates through four segments: Engine Products, Fastening Systems, Engineered Structures, and Forged Wheels.
